Contains a condensed and easy to use section on the fundamental teaching skills, integration,pshychology for instructors, a section for new instructors and the Stages of Rider Education, which give an orderly progression to what to teach with steps and exercises. Each Stage is organized with a section on Goals, Theory, Important Points, The Ideal and Real World issues and Practical Application. Information is easy to access and use.
